Things to do in the Museum |
|
|
Visit the new Spark!Lab, the "Invention at Play" and "America on the Move" exhibitions, and pick up a free family guide to hunt for faces of American history. Look for hands-on carts, see the new Star-Spangled Banner exhibition and its interactive table, and don't miss Kermit the frog or Dorothy's ruby slippers!
